The EcoAmazonia Lodge is located about 35 km down the Madre de Dios River from Puerto Maldonado and takes about 1½ to get their by boat. This comfortable lodge is one of the best in the region - there are 40 rustic bungalows, each with private bathroom and a screened sitting room with hammocks. |

The beds all have mosquito nets and lighting is by kerosene lamp. The food is served in what is as close to a proper restaurant as you get in the jungle. |
|
There are several trails of varying length leading from the lodge, including a 3 hour hike to a canopy observation platform. One of the highlights is the nearby Qocha Perdida lagoon. The lodge also offers boat tours along smaller tributaries. Overall this EcoAmazonia Lodge suits the capabilities and preferences of most guests making it popular with tour groups so book in advance. |
